The way a community takes care of its children - their health, welfare, education and development - is a key indication of its values, aspirations and problem-solving abilities. Newsrooms traditionally have set up coverage of children focused on education or schools, definitions that narrow the lens and inevitably fix the focus on institutions.
We aim to go beyond that, to tell meaningful stories with solutions-oriented angles about how parents, educators, public officials and the community collectively plan for the future of our children.
This beat will demand deep source-building and consistent engagement, and the ability to tell stories on different platforms and in varied formats.

The Miami Times and Biscayne Times newspapers in Miami, FL, are seeking a smart and aggressive writer to join their teams. These sister newspapers are owned by the same publisher. The Miami Times is a historic weekly newspaper that has served the Black community for nearly 100 years, and Biscayne Times is a geographically targeted monthly news magazine that serves an affluent, general market demographic.
We are looking for an ambitious reporter to produce meaningful journalism that takes time, research, and effort to develop, and who can find the angle daily news beat reporters often miss or ignore.
Solid research skills, aggressive use of public records laws, facility with data and an ability to develop sources are a must. Also critical is your ability to establish trust and credibility with elected officials and their staff, among other key influencers and stakeholders in the community. You'll be expected to follow leads and produce high-impact, enterprise and watchdog stories for the monthly magazine amid the demands of occasionally reporting for the weekly newspaper in a supercharged landscape rife with identity politics. Coverage areas include Miami-Dade County government, City of Miami, and other municipalities north through Aventura and all island communities in between in a constantly evolving multi-cultural environment that is often in the national spotlight.
Beat discipline and organizational skills are essential to balance the need for depth and enterprise with the need to remain competitive. You should be nimble and able to tailor your storytelling to satisfy readers of both publications, whose audiences only occasionally overlap depending on subject matter.
This position also demands occasional reporting in real-time for our online platforms and via social media and an aptitude for shooting photography to help tell your story. Past political coverage and previous experience writing for an established publication are preferred, but solid writing skills (established through writing samples), a can-do attitude, and a demonstrated work ethic matter more. Adherence to AP style and journalistic ethics is required.

Twin Falls - with nearly 60,000 residents - is the largest town in our coverage area and is often called the "Gateway to the Snake River Canyon.
Snake River Canyon is a hub for outdoor recreation. You can kayak, paddleboard, fish, or take a scenic boat ride along the river. Trails along the rim are perfect for hiking, biking, and catching incredible sunsets.
Shoshone Falls, known as the "Niagara of the West," are actually taller than Niagara and are breathtaking in the spring when water flow is at its peak. The park offers picnic areas, trails, and scenic overlooks. The iconic Perrine Bridge spans the Snake River Canyon and is one of the only places in the U.S. where BASE jumping is legal year-round. Even if you don't jump, the views are unforgettable, and you can often spot adventurers leaping into the canyon below.
Downtown Twin Falls - After exploring, stroll downtown for locally owned shops, art galleries, coffee houses, and great dining options ranging from farm-to-table cuisine to Idaho's famous potatoes served in creative ways.
Golf, Hot Springs, and Skiing - The region also offers golf courses with canyon views, relaxing hot springs, and scenic drives through farmland and rolling hills. World-class skiing at Sun Valley is just a few hours' drive away.
